Tracking OpenAI Codex Usage Limit Resets and Milestone Celebrations

Codex Resets

I track the frequent resets of OpenAI's Codex usage limits, often announced unexpectedly by thsottiaux on X. These resets occur to celebrate user growth milestones, resolve technical glitches, or simply boost community morale. With an average interval of nearly nine days, these generous gestures ensure paid users of Codex and ChatGPT Work can continue building without hitting rate limits.
